I took Drivers Ed back in high school. Not sure they even offer such a thing now. But back then, car dealers would let the schools have "demo's" of new cars to use in drivers ed. I took it in the Summer so we all got extended drive time behind the wheel of these cars. Some of these demo's were better than others. The group I was in got this 1975 Grand Prix SJ with a 455cid engine with only 3000 miles on it. It would get up and go. Entering the highway, the instructor (a football coach) would yell, punch it, punch it...get up to highway speed. Well, that car had no problem doing that. Fun times.

Combo of 3 different cars. My driver's Ed car was a '73 Chevy Laguna 2dr htp and the instuctor just kept us out on the country roads instead of going into the city. I learned the most bombing around the gravel logging roads in my sister's (at the time and handed down to me)1963 Dodge Dart 4dr with slant 6 and 3-on-the-tree. Parents got it at a state surplus auction with 200,000 + miles on it. The third car was mom's '71 Datsun 510 4dr with 4spd. Anytime she needed to go anywhere, she'd ask me to drive her and toss me the keys. WOW, that car comes with a factory racing suspension and was fun to drive. They're hard to find because so many people would simply strap down the suspension to lower and stiffen it, slap a number on the door, and go weekend warrior racing in them.
